
Oklahoma homeowners in Tulsa and throughout the state face dynamic weather patterns that impact garage doors. The region experiences hot, dry summers, severe thunderstorms, and occasional cold snaps, requiring durable and adaptable garage door systems, especially for the bottom seal.
In Oklahoma, garage door bottom seals are constantly tested by extreme weather. Hot summers can dry out and crack standard seals, while severe thunderstorms bring heavy rain and wind that can force their way through compromised seals. Winter brings colder temperatures that can make seals brittle. A failing bottom seal in Tulsa leads to significant energy loss, allowing heat and cold to enter, and can be an entry point for dust and pests common in the area.
